What Is an AED?

An Automated External Defibrillator (AED) is a mobile device utilized to restore a normal heart rhythm during unexpected heart attack. The gadget assesses the heart's rhythm and delivers an electrical shock if it detects a dangerous arrhythmia.

image

How Does It Work?

The AED operates via a collection of uncomplicated actions:

Turn on the device. Attach electrode pads to the individual's bare chest. The AED will automatically assess the heart's rhythm. If a shock is suggested, it will certainly instruct you to stand clear and deliver the shock.

How to Make use of an AED Detailed Australia

Using an AED can seem complicated, yet comprehending its procedure can conserve lives. Here's a step-by-step overview tailored for Australians:

Step 1: Analyze the Situation

Ensure the location is safe for both you and the victim before proceeding.

image

Step 2: Call Emergency Services

Dial 000 immediately or have someone else do it while you attend to the patient.

Step 3: Prepare the Patient

Lay the patient level on their back and subject their chest.

Step 4: Attach Electrode Pads

Follow aesthetic directions supplied with the pads; one pad takes place the upper right breast and another on the lower left side.

Step 5: Evaluate Heart Rhythm

Press "Analyze" if prompted by your AED; guarantee no one is touching the person during analysis.

Step 6: Supply Shock if Advised

If a shock is suggested, make certain everyone is clear before pressing "Shock."

Step 7: Resume CPR

Regardless of whether a shock was provided or otherwise, proceed CPR up until emergency solutions show up or the person shows signs of life.

AED Usage on Kid Australia

Using an AED on children varies slightly from adults:

    Use pediatric pads if available. Follow certain standards for kids under eight years of ages or evaluating less than 25 kg. Always seek expert medical support immediately when managing minors in emergencies.

AED Battery Maintenance Australia

Maintaining your AED's battery is crucial for guaranteeing it runs correctly when required:

Regularly check battery degrees as shown by LED lights. Replace batteries according to supplier standards-- usually every two to five years. Keep extra batteries in stock where your AED is located.
